Kagawa is a Japanese securities brokerage and investment services firm that has been operating since 1944. The company has established itself as a significant player in Japan's financial services industry. Kagawa Securities Co. represents a well-established presence in Japan's financial services sector. The company commenced operations in 1944 during the post-war reconstruction period. The company has evolved alongside Japan's economic development, positioning itself as a significant participant in the domestic brokerage industry. Over nearly eight decades of operation, Kagawa has built its reputation on providing securities brokerage and investment services to Japanese investors, maintaining a focus on comprehensive trading support and client service.
The firm's business model centers on traditional securities brokerage combined with modern investment services. It adapts to technological advances while maintaining its core service philosophy. Kagawa demonstrates strong credentials in trust and reliability through its regulation by Japan's Financial Services Agency. This is one of the world's most respected financial regulatory bodies. The Japan FSA maintains rigorous oversight standards, requiring licensed firms to adhere to strict capital adequacy requirements, client fund segregation protocols, and operational transparency standards.
The broker's establishment in 1944 provides substantial evidence of operational longevity and market survival through various economic cycles and regulatory changes. This extensive operational history suggests institutional stability and the ability to maintain business continuity across different market conditions. It represents a significant trust factor for potential clients.
Kagawa's sustained presence in Japan's competitive financial services market indicates successful adaptation to evolving regulatory requirements and market demands. The company's ability to maintain operations for nearly eight decades demonstrates management competency and business model viability.
